解决git报错: error: failed to push some refs to....

原因

  • 远程仓库和本地仓库不一致

解决方案

  • 报错类似如: error: failed to push some refs to ‘https://github.com/'

  • 原因: 远程仓库与本地仓库内容不一致. 尝试远程仓库同步到本地, 如果失败直接强制刷掉远程仓库的内容.

  • 远程仓库同步到本地仓库(如果此步骤失败, 直接强制推送.)

    git pull --rebase origin main  ##把远程仓库同步到本地仓库
    

强制推送

git push -u origin main -f # 强制推送
posted @ 2021-05-16 21:54  南方与南  阅读(218)  评论(0)    收藏  举报